LINUX.ORG.RU

SATA HotPlug: возможно ли?


0

2

Давно интересовал такой вопрос: можно ли на горячую подключать или отключать SATA-диски? Если да, то обязательно ли для этого использовать какой-либо Mobile Rack, или же безопасно делать это напрямую?

В общем, хочется побольше информации на данный счет из реального опыта :)

Ответ на: комментарий от Deleted

Про eSATA знаю, но вопрос именно про обычный SATA, внутренний.

aix27249
() автор топика

Постоянно отключаю и sata и pata - никаких проблем. Если контроллер не поддерживает hot-plug/plug and play или как там еще это называется, в общем не уведомляет о подключении/отключении устройств, то нужно перед отключением делать
echo 1 >/sys/block/sda/device/delete
после подключения соответственно
echo '- - -' >/sys/class/scsi_host/host0/scan
Вместо sda подставляем sdb/sdc/sr0/sr1 и т.д., вместо host0 - host1, host2 и т.д., пока не появится новое устройство.

anonymous
()

Безопасно, SATA проектировался с поддержкой хотплага

Bad_Habit
()

Без проблем. SATA II предусматривает хотплаг в обязательном порядке, но многие диски SATA поддерживают эту возможность и так (Seagate точно должны).

В общем, хочется побольше информации на данный счет из реального опыта :)

УМВР :) Дёргаю периодически, проблем ни разу не было. Главное, не забывать удалять устройство из ОС.

GotF ★★★★★
()

Когда увидел в магазине как их спецы SATA-хард на горячую втыкали просто обалдел. Дома попробовал - вполне себе работает.

Единственный замеченный глюк, под Win на недоRAID Si3112 или подобном, когда на горячую дёргаешь один из винтов в массиве, система коматозится на минуту и иногда уходит в себя насовсем. С одиночными хардами подключенными к материнке проблем не было.

tx
()

Спасибо всем за ответы! На досуге буду пробовать данный финт :)

aix27249
() автор топика
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.